I learned about zipper flowers from Cathy, and I wondered how one might look if I added some tatting I started with some pink perle size 8, but, then I thought that the pink might not show up as well as I'd like against the pink zipper. Lady Shuttlemaker's Rio was perfect.
The colors show well against the pinkI tatted more fancy picot chain, then gathered the zipper fabric, and sewed it into a flower.
Here's the result. I added a topping of 3 JK flowers with seed bead centers.
What do you think?
My conclusions:
- this flower is quite pouffy and the long picots hide the zipper
- it might work out better if I used a shorter zipper for this type of flower
- I could use shorter picots, perhaps, so the zipper would be more visible
- tatting on the zipper flower top might be all that's necessary
- a zipper with the metal teeth might show up better against the tatting
I started a second flower type with a shorter fancy picot, but no results so far.
